Allan L. Gropper was appointed as a United States Bankruptcy Judge for the Southern District of New York on October 4, 2000. Prior thereto he was a member of the law firm of White & Case and represented clients in connection with many of the nation=s largest Chapter 11 cases, including Manville Corporation, Texaco, LTV Corporation, Federated Department Stores/Allied Stores Corp, Maxwell Communications Corp., MGM, United States Lines, Pan American World Airways, and Waterman Steamship Corp. He was also active in international insolvencies and restructurings and was located in the White & Case Hong Kong office during the year 1999-2000. Judge Gropper is a co-editor of a two-volume text entitled International Insolvency published in 2000, an adjunct professor of law at Fordham Law School, a member of the National Bankruptcy Conference and a Fellow of the American College of Bankruptcy. He is a graduate of Yale College and Harvard Law School.
